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
802465 0908 4439 57692 7558080009
8043122188 33848 70655521
8043122188 33848 70655521
68087 337 209054 208864
All about undefined
Interested in learning more?
8043122188 33848 70655521
68087 337 209054 208864
See more
85 732630539 023556
11 7013 91 05
See more
253213777 26894
392476289 83949 517343884
See more